• Updates are sometimes included with the system to describe changes to the system, software, and/or documentation. NOTE: Always check for updates on support.dell.com and read the updates first because they often supersede information in other documents. • Release notes or readme files may be included to provide last-minute updates to the system or documentation or advanced technical reference material intended for experienced users or technicians. Obtaining Technical Assistance If you do not understand a procedure in this guide or if the system does not perform as expected, see your Hardware Owner's Manual. Dell Enterprise Training and Certification is available; see www.dell.com/training for more information. This service may not be offered in all locations. Installation and Configuration CAUTION: Before performing the following procedure, read and follow the safety instructions and important regulatory information in your Product Information Guide. CAUTION: Whenever you need to lift the system, get others to assist you. To avoid injury, do not attempt to lift the system by yourself. This section describes the steps to set up your system for the first time. Unpacking the System Unpack your system and identify each item. Keep all shipping materials in case you need them later.
